Hi team,
I am trying to enable dsi display with imx8mp.
As suggested in the forum, i tried to add st7701 with the device tree as below
&lcdif1 {
status = "okay";
};
&mipi_dsi {status = "okay";
panel@0 {
compatible = "techstar,ts8550b";
reg = <0>;
dsi-lanes = <2>;
};
};
I tried to boot the board and i am getting the following error.
[ 6.813406] imx-drm display-subsystem: bound imx-lcdifv3-crtc.0 (ops lcdifv3_crtc_ops)
[ 6.979483] imx-drm display-subsystem: bound imx-lcdifv3-crtc.1 (ops lcdifv3_crtc_ops)
[ 7.118113] imx-drm display-subsystem: bound imx-lcdifv3-crtc.2 (ops lcdifv3_crtc_ops)
[7.144740] imx_sec_dsim_drv 32e60000.mipi_dsi: Unbalanced imx_sec_dsi!
m.[ 7.169083] imx_sec_dsim_drv 32e60000.mipi_dsi: version number is 0x1060200
[ 7.186515] panel-sitronix-st7701 32e60000.mipi_dsi.0: supply v3p3 not found, using dur
[ 7.219249] panel-sitronix-st7701 32e60000.mipi_dsi.0: supply v1p8 not found, using dummy regulator
[ 7.243099] imx_sec_dsim_drv 32e60000.mipi_dsi: unsupported dsi mode
[ 7.249684] panel-sitronix-st7701: probe of 32e60000.mipi_dsi.0 failed with error -22[ 7.303549] imx_sec_dsim_drv 32e60000.mipi_dsi: failed to bind sec dsim bridge: -517
[ 7.433465] imx_sec_dsim_drv 32e60000.mipi_dsi: Unbalanced imx_sec_dsim_runtime_resume!

Hi @DEEPIKA19
The core log: 'unsupported dsi mode', you need check your panel driver about dsi mode.
